JavaScript 参考手册 目录

Frame/IFrame src 属性

Frame/IFrame src 属性详解

在 web 前端开发中,Frame 和 IFrame 是两种常用的标签,用于在页面中嵌入其他页面或者内容。它们可以帮助我们实现页面的模块化、异步加载、以及跨域通信等功能。其中,src 属性是 Frame 和 IFrame 最重要的属性之一,它定义了嵌入页面的地址。

Frame 和 IFrame 的区别

在介绍 src 属性之前,我们先来看一下 Frame 和 IFrame 的区别。

  1. Frame:Frame 是 HTML4 中定义的标签,用于将页面分割成多个区域,每个区域可以加载不同的页面。但是由于 Frame 标签会导致 SEO 难度增加、页面结构混乱等问题,现在已经很少被使用。

  2. IFrame:IFrame 是 HTML5 中定义的标签,用于在当前页面中嵌入另一个页面。IFrame 可以实现异步加载、跨域通信等功能,是目前比较常用的方案。

src 属性的作用

src 属性是 Frame 和 IFrame 中最重要的属性之一,它定义了嵌入页面的地址。通过设置 src 属性,我们可以指定要加载的页面,从而实现页面的嵌套和内容的展示。

如何使用 src 属性

接下来,我将介绍如何在代码中使用 src 属性来实现 Frame 和 IFrame 的嵌套。

使用 Frame

--------- -----
------
------
    ------------ ----------
-------
--------- ---------------
    ------ ----------------
    ------ -----------------
-----------
-------

在上面的示例中,我们使用 frameset 和 frame 标签来实现页面的分割,并通过设置 src 属性加载不同的页面。

使用 IFrame

--------- -----
------
------
    ------------- ----------
-------
------
    ------------
    ------- ---------------- ----------- ----------------------
-------
-------

在上面的示例中,我们使用 iframe 标签来嵌入另一个页面,并通过设置 src 属性加载指定的页面。

总结

通过本文的介绍,我们了解了 Frame 和 IFrame 标签的区别,以及 src 属性的作用和如何使用。在实际开发中,我们可以根据需求选择合适的标签和属性来实现页面的嵌套和内容展示。希望本文对你有所帮助!


下一篇:概览